Transaction 61cbbe72fceb230e7c0d83f0a4fbe4c2f69ee8d97fda664b8329b2882f524c51

1 Input
2 Outputs
  • 61cbbe72fceb230e7c0d83f0a4fbe4c2f69ee8d97fda664b8329b2882f524c51:0
  • value  59552455
    address  1Pc8hpEZSwe4Tbv5fYv6ctJo22SSxHU5Zh
  • 61cbbe72fceb230e7c0d83f0a4fbe4c2f69ee8d97fda664b8329b2882f524c51:1
  • value  23192619
    address  14mo7jsFfyckVNBRDNUnVDy4bhP1tPNMgX